That is not a switch. It is just a pull out disconnect. Flipping it
over so it says OFF NO is just where you store it when the power is
off.

Well, when I look it up on the internet it's called a disconnect switch. There
is something definitely wrong somewhere when the unit will NOT shut off unless
I pull this switch out.


It is just a pullout disconnect. The HP running all the time might be
the thermostat. That is what I would try first. Is it a solid state or
old school with a mercury bulb? If it is solid state try pulling the
batteries and see if it keeps running.
